Abstract

This utility model discloses a positioning and resetting device, including a panel for carrying a battery and two sets of resetting mechanisms correspondingly arranged on the panel; each set of resetting mechanisms includes a resetting push block arranged along a first direction of the panel and a driving mechanism for driving the resetting push block to reciprocate along the first direction of the panel; a sensor is installed on the resetting push block along its direction of movement, and the sensor is electrically connected to the driving mechanism through a control unit; this utility model breaks through the limitation of vehicle parking distance in traditional battery swapping methods. Within the allowable range, as long as the vehicle is parked normally, the resetting mechanism can identify or reset the position of the battery after the panel receives the battery, thus achieving precise battery swapping.

Technical Field

[0001] This utility model relates to the field of electric vehicle battery swapping technology, and in particular to a positioning and resetting device. Background Technology

[0002] Against the backdrop of the rapid development of the electric vehicle industry, battery swapping technology has become a key means to solve the problem of charging time for electric vehicles due to its advantage of being able to quickly replenish vehicle range. Among them, chassis battery swapping technology has been widely used in the industry because it is compatible with a wide range of models and has a relatively mature battery swapping process.

[0003] The core process of current chassis battery swapping technology is as follows: First, the depleted battery is removed from the battery compartment at the bottom of the electric vehicle, and then transported to a designated location by a transfer trolley. Next, a fully charged battery is transported to the underside of the vehicle by the same transfer trolley and installed into the battery compartment to complete the swap. However, this process is limited by vehicle parking accuracy—due to differences in driver operating habits and parking guidance errors at the battery swapping station, the actual parking position of the vehicle often deviates from the standard parking position. This causes the depleted battery to be offset on the transfer trolley's bearing surface when it is lowered from the battery compartment, meaning the battery position does not match the preset standard bearing position of the transfer trolley. [0012] The specific embodiments of this utility model will be described in further detail below with reference to the accompanying drawings and examples. The following examples are used to illustrate this utility model, but are not intended to limit its scope.

[0013] Example 1 See Figure 1-4 As shown, this embodiment provides a positioning and resetting device, including a panel 1 for carrying a battery and two sets of resetting mechanisms 2 correspondingly arranged on the panel 1. Each set of reset mechanisms 2 includes a reset push block 2-1 arranged along the first direction of panel 1 (in this embodiment, it can be defined as the width direction or the length direction, depending on the actual situation) and a drive mechanism 2-2 that drives the reset push block 2-1 to reciprocate along the first direction of panel 1. A sensor 2-3 is mounted on the reset push block 2-1 along its direction of movement. The sensor 2-3 is electrically connected to the drive mechanism 2-2 through the control unit.

[0014] It should be noted that the two reset push blocks 2-1 move closer or further apart under the drive of the two drive mechanisms 2-2.

[0015] It should be noted that the detection direction of sensor 2-3 is parallel to the movement direction of reset push block 2-1, and the detection directions of sensor 2-3 on the two reset push blocks 2-1 are opposite to each other.

[0016] Specifically, the reset mechanism 2 records the position information of the side wall of the battery (or battery compartment) and pushes to adjust the side wall, thereby ensuring that the battery (or battery compartment) can be position recorded and adjusted, ensuring accuracy.

[0017] Specifically, such as Figure 3 The drive mechanism 2-2 includes a drive motor 2-201, a rectangular pull wire assembly 2-202, and a connecting seat 2-203; The direction of motion of the output end of the drive motor 2-201 is perpendicular to the direction of motion of the second reset push block 2-1; The rectangular guy wire assembly 2-202 includes four sets of guy wire seats 2-2021 arranged in a rectangle, and each set of guy wire seats 2-2021 is equipped with a rotating wheel 2-2022 that rotates horizontally. Four sets of rotating wheels 2-2022 are fitted with drive cables 2-204 connected end to end, and the drive cables 2-204 are rectangular; A portion of the drive cable 2-204 overlaps with the movement path of the reset push block 2-1; The output end of the drive motor 2-201 is connected to the drive cable 2-204; A slot 1-1 is provided on panel 1 along the movement path of reset push block 2-1; The reset pusher 2-1 is connected to the connecting seat 2-203 through the slot 1-1; The connecting seat 2-203 is connected to a portion of the drive pull wire 2-204 that overlaps with the motion path of the reset push block 2-1.

[0018] When the output end of the drive motor 2-201 extends or retracts, it drives the drive cable 2-204 to rotate, which in turn drives the connecting seat 2-203 to move, and further drives the reset push block 2-1 to move.

[0019] In addition, to ensure the movement direction of the reset push block 2-1, a guide mechanism 2-4 is also included at the bottom of the panel 1, see Figure 4 The guide mechanism 2-4 includes a slide rail arranged parallel to the movement path of the reset push block 2-1 and a slider adapted to the slide rail; the connecting seat 2-203 connects the slider.

[0020] Specifically, panel 1 can be installed on top of the transfer trolley to facilitate battery adjustment and transfer in conjunction with the transfer trolley.

[0021] It should be noted that sensor 2-3 is a proximity sensor. After sensor 2-3 detects proximity, it sends a stop operation command to drive motor 2-201. The PLC records the distance pushed out by the push rod of drive motor 2-201.

[0022] Specifically, this technology can adjust the position of the battery carried on the panel 1 by cooperating with two sets of reset mechanisms 2. After the battery is removed, it can be adjusted to a suitable position. When the battery is installed, it can also be readjusted back to the position suitable for vehicle installation. That is, adjustments can be made after the battery is removed and adjustments can also be made when the battery is installed.
